This could have been done a lot safer by putting a snatch block between the wheel and the truck to change the direction of the pull, so it doesn't smash your truck if the chain comes off or the cable breaks. Put a chain over the cable so if it does break it doesn't go flying. And definitely use a long remote on the winch.
